There are nine boxes, three of which contain oranges and the rest apples. Three girls and six
boys randomly select a box each. Find the probability that
(a) the girls select more boxes which contain oranges than the boys.

[3 marks]

(b) none of the girls has a box which contain oranges.

[3 marks]

The lifespan of a certain torch battery is normally distributed with a mean of 150 hours and a
standard deviation of 10 hours.
(a) Find the probability that a randomly chosen torch battery has a lifespan of not less than
160 hours.
[2 marks]
(b) Determine the value of t, to the nearest integer, if it is found that 5% of the batteries are
exhausted after t hours.
[4 marks]

12 The result of a diagnostic test for a certain infection may be negative or positive, but the test is
not completely reliable. If an individual has the infection, the probability that the result will be
negative is 0.01. If an individual does not have the infection, the probability that the result will
be negative is 0.95. In a certain population, the percentage of the population affected by the
infection is 8%.
(a) An individual is chosen at random and tested.
i)

Find the probability that the result of the test is negative.

[0.1252] [4 marks]

ii)

If the result of the test is negative, show that the probability of the individual not infected is
0.999, by giving your answer correct to three decimal places.
[2 marks]

(b) Estimate the percentage of the population which shows positive results for two
independent diagnostic tests. [3 marks][1.56%]
(c) Find the probability that in a sample of ten independent diagnostic tests, more than two
results are positive. [0.8022][4 marks]
